Ryan: ‘We Will Proceed with Tax Reform’

‘Now we’re going to move on with the rest of our agenda because we have big ambitious plans to improve people’s lives in this country’

RUSH EXCERPT:

RYAN: "Our members know we did everything we could to get consensus. This is how governing works when you’re in the majority. We need 216 people to agree with each other to write legislation. Not 210, not 215. We need 216 people in the house to agree with each other on how to write a piece of legislation. We didn’t have 216 people. We were close. We did not have 216 people. That’s how legislating works. So now we’re going to move on with the rest of our agenda because we have big ambitious plans to improve people’s lives in this country. We want to secure the border, rebuild our military. We want to get the deficit under control. We want infrastructure and tax reform. Yes, this does make tax reform more difficult but doesn’t make it impossible. We will proceed with tax reform and continue with tax reform. That’s an issue I know about. I used to run that committee. I spoke with the president and his economic advisors earlier today about tax reform. So we’re going to proceed with tax reform."
